Everything here is SO GOOD. I was meeting a friend for lunch here and while waiting ended up ordering a ham and cheese roll because I couldn't wait to eat lol. It was tasty and light and is probably even better fresh out of the oven. For my meal I had the soy sauce marinated pork chops, which was hearty and filling. The meat was tender with a slight crisp, and the rice steaming hot. I absolutely inhaled the whole plate. Charlie's is also known around town for their desserts. On a second trip a week later my fiancé and I had a Boston Cream Pie and Irish cream cheesecake. They were light and the perfect amount of sweetness. They had a lot of business on a Saturday afternoon with people dining in and picking up orders to go. Sometimes it gets busy and all tables are full, but the food is worth the wait. You won't be disappointed here!

Charlie's Bakery is a Chinese restaurant and bakery, with a lot of traditional menu items and baked goods. They have plenty of seating. I almost jokingly describe how they are one of the cleanest Chinese bakeries I've ever seen, ok, I'm only half joking. My wife and I were in town for a trip and found this place through online searching. We went during lunchtime and it seemed to be pretty full which was a good sign. I ordered their braised beef noodle soup (spicy), and I ordered their spicy wontons. My wife had a seafood noodle soup. The food came out in a timely manner, they brought the order to our table. The noodles were standard egg noodles but the braised beef and the broth was really good. I'd go there again.

Charlie's Bakery continues to satisfy. Went in at 8pm, they mentioned they'd be closing at 8:30, we ordered and food was out starting in 5 minutes. Mongolian beef, sesame chicken, both sub chicken fried rice for a small up charge (worth it), har gow, pork siu mai, and pork Szechwan spicy wontons. Fast, friendly, delicious. Order at the counter, pictures of food are on the wall. Soda, water, soy sauce, & chili sauces are self-serve. Chopsticks are crap, I will bring my own next time . Still 10/10

Although we'd researched this spot for breakfast/brunch bakery, we first came for dinner, noted that the bakery was almost totally sold out, and made a mental note that if we wanted to try their baked goods, we'd have to come again and arrive early! For dinner we enjoyed Egg Rolls, Shrimp Won Ton Soup with Noodles, and the Braised Beef Noodle Soup, all of which were delicious--some of the most delicate won tons I've ever had! When we came back another day for brunch, we sampled a few buns: Sausage, Egg, & Cheese; BBQ Pork; and Red Bean. The BBQ Pork was my favorite of the two savory buns--savory and lightly sweet--and you can never go wrong with red bean buns! Would definitely return if we're ever back in Anchorage, and if I was a local I'd be a regular for sure!
